Certain titles like God of War Collection or Sonic Unleashed will drop execution threads if the audio buffer runs dry, forcing a sudden crash. Go to > Audio . Locate the Audio Buffer Duration slider.

Corrupted shader caches or LLVM caches can cause a game to crash instantly upon boot or during gameplay transitions. In the main RPCS3 window, right-click your game. Hover over and select Clear Shader Cache . Next, select Clear LLVM Cache .
